Output 63ff5c7a847374a5b14d54f93a67c3935f8289010537335a7185d4d0e60d05fa:1

value
24310000
script pubkey
OP_0 OP_PUSHBYTES_20 c15fea17447656b95e3ac4093c48a05c3c21e45c
address
ltc1qc907596ywettjh36csyncj9qts7zrezu0ju7ax
transaction
63ff5c7a847374a5b14d54f93a67c3935f8289010537335a7185d4d0e60d05fa
spent
true